   SkyBridge - Specifications
space.gif (43 bytes)

Technical Specifications

SkyBridge Satellites

CONSTELLATION   DESCRIPTION

Number of Satellites 80 satellites total
Geometry Two 40 satellite sub-constellations with 20 planes, each containing four satellites.
Orbit LEO - 
    Final:    1469 km (885 miles) circular, 53 deg
    Parking: 940 km (566 miles) circular, 53 deg
Orbit Period Final Orbit:      115.3 minutes
Parking Orbit:  103.8 minutes
Coverage (estimated) between 68 degrees North and South Latitude
Initiation of Operations

2002 - Planned

Launch Vehicle(s)

Ariane 5, Proton, Atlas 3, Delta III

PAYLOAD CAPABILITIES

Types of Services

broadband:  voice, video, data, internet

Transmission Rate

2,400 to 9,600 subscriber uplink
24,000 subscriber downlink
50,000 gateway uplink and downlink

Data Rate 200 Gbps - max system capacity
On-board processing No
Mobile downlink frequencies 

10.7 to 12.75 GHz (Ku Band)

Mobile uplink frequencies

12.75 to 14.5 GHz (Ku Band)

Multiple access scheme

18 Spot Beams per satellite

Right Hand Circular Polarization ('RHCP') and Left Hand Circular Polarization ('LHCP')

Voice or data circuit capacity per satellite

 

CORE BUS SPECIFICATIONS

Prime Contractor Alcatel, Space Systems Loral
Platform  
Launch Mass

1250 kg (2756 lb)

Dry Mass 1200 kg (2646 lb) - estimated
Design Life

5 to 7 years

STRUCTURE

Dimensions (H x W x L)

2 m x 1 m x 4 m (6.6 ft x 3.3 ft x 13.2 ft)

Construction Composite Honeycomb

POWER SYSTEM

Payload Power (EOL)

5 kW - estimated

Solar Arrays

Two - sun pointing

ATTITUDE CONTROL SYSTEM

Stabilization

Three Axis
